The Importance of Temperature and Humidity Control in Wine Storage

Proper temperature and humidity control are essential for successful wine storage.

Maintaining the ideal conditions in a wine cellar is crucial for preserving the quality and aging process of wines.

Temperature management plays a significant role in ensuring that wines age gracefully and develop their desired flavors and aromas.

Smart temperature sensors are a game-changer in the wine industry.

These innovative devices allow wine producers to monitor the temperature of their wine cellars remotely and in real-time.

By using smart temperature sensors, you can ensure that your wine cellar is always within the optimal temperature range, preventing any damage that may occur due to fluctuations in temperature.

Humidity control is equally important for wine storage.

The right humidity level prevents the corks from drying out and the wine from evaporating.

Smart temperature sensors can be complemented with humidity control systems to maintain the ideal humidity level in the wine cellar.

This ensures that your wines age properly and maintain their quality over time.

Table: Recommended Temperature and Humidity Levels for Wine Storage

 TemperatureHumidity
Recommended Range10°C – 16°C65% – 75%
Target Temperature12°CN/A

By implementing smart temperature sensors and humidity control systems in your wine cellar, you can ensure that your wines are stored in optimal conditions, allowing them to age gracefully and reach their full potential.

WHY IS TEMPERATURE AND HUMIDITY CONTROL IMPORTANT IN WINE STORAGE?

Proper temperature and humidity control are crucial to maintain the quality and longevity of wine.

High temperatures can accelerate aging, while low temperatures can hinder the aging process.

Inadequate humidity can lead to cork drying and wine evaporation, while excessive humidity can cause mold growth.
